With the maturity of oil exploration technology, greener, more efficient way of exploitation has been more attention..Shenyang University of Technology developed snubbing workover rig skid-mounted hydraulic control system independently, which is used for workover operations. The hydraulic control system which works with the derrick can perform workover operations in the oil (gas) wellhead with pressure situations. Snubbing workover rig skid-mounted hydraulic control system is a equipment which install hydraulic, electrical, and operating handle in a movable hydraulic control room. The hydraulic control equipment could transport by car to the oilfield wellhead nearby to complete workover operations. The operator completes operations work, such as the lift of lifting cylinder, the switch of blowout preventer and some other auxiliary operations work, in the hydraulic control room.The hydraulic control system is analyzed and designed by three programs, which are hydraulic program, skid-mounted hydraulic control room program and electrical control systems and auxiliary electrical control systems with detection feedback unit program.The hydraulic program introduces the thought of the design schematics of hydraulic and the selection of component. The hydraulic design program also discusses the solution of hydraulic cylinder interlock and variable pump explosion proof. The program of hydraulic control room design discusses the selection of room size and the overall layout of the device.
